Guide to Forcing External Input Data File Bits

The following occurs in the Run or Test mode:

Forcing of input data file bits and resultant data changes appear in the
data file displays.

The ladder program is scanned and ladder logic is applied.

Instruction state boxes are filled for true bit instructions.

The table below shows the keys and key sequences involved with setting and
clearing forces. A confirmation screen appears following each of these.

If the controller is in RRUN, RCSN, or RSSN, the bit is forced
Off and the data file bit remains forced until the force is
removed.
